Let's dive into the specifics to see if it lives up to the hype.\n\n## Key Features of the Atkins Endulge Caramel Nut Chew Bar\n\n Low Sugar Content: Formulated to be low in sugar, making it suitable for individuals managing their carbohydrate intake.\n High in Fiber: Contains a significant amount of fiber, promoting satiety and aiding in digestive health.\n Delicious Caramel and Nut Flavor: Offers a classic caramel and nut combination that appeals to a wide range of palates.\n Convenient On-the-Go Snack: Individually wrapped bars for easy portability and consumption anytime, anywhere.\n Part of the Atkins Diet Plan: Integrates seamlessly into the Atkins diet program as a permissible and enjoyable treat.\n\n## Pros: What Makes the Atkins Endulge Bar Stand Out?\n\n Satisfies Sweet Cravings Without the Sugar Crash: The low sugar content prevents the energy slump often associated with sugary snacks, making it a better choice for sustained energy levels. It uses sugar alcohols and artificial sweeteners to achieve this.\n Excellent Source of Fiber Promotes Fullness: The high fiber content helps you feel full and satisfied, reducing the likelihood of overeating. This is particularly helpful for weight management.\n Convenient and Portable for On-the-Go Snacking: The individually wrapped bars are perfect for stashing in your bag, desk drawer, or car, making them a convenient option when you need a quick and satisfying snack. No preparation required.\n\n## Cons: Areas for Improvement\n\n Artificial Sweeteners May Cause Digestive Issues for Some: The presence of sugar alcohols like maltitol can lead to digestive discomfort, such as bloating or gas, in sensitive individuals. \n Taste May Not Appeal to Everyone: While the caramel and nut combination is generally popular, some may find the artificial sweeteners leave a slightly artificial or lingering aftertaste compared to traditional candy bars like Snickers or Milky Way.
